Output 39310f01e16897b512337f6e2475d535a85098cfb7a099a03a3c9084df31556d:0

value
3521557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89c73ecb297d9219009a8080f51bfcbcde5994a4 OP_EQUAL
address
3EFXBdUtKTcHBAYytw7TH8A1XrCifqixFV
transaction
39310f01e16897b512337f6e2475d535a85098cfb7a099a03a3c9084df31556d
spent
true